【摘要】 非线性泛函分析是现代分析数学的一个重要分支,它能够清楚的解释自然界中很多自然现象,因而受到了越来越多的数学家与数学工作者的关注。其中,非线性初值与边值问题来源于应用数学和物理的多个分支,是目前分析数学中研究最为活跃的领域之一。本文利用锥理论,不动点定理,不动点指数方法,上下解方法等研究了几类积微分方程奇异边值问题解的情况,获得了一些新的结果。根据内容本文分为以下四章:第一章第一章是本文的绪论部分。主要介绍了本文的研究课题。第二章本文允许h(t)在t=0和t=1奇异,利用Krasnoselskii不动点定理和Leggett-Williams不动点定理,得到了二阶三点边值问题多个正解的存在性结果。第三章本文允许h(t)在t=0和t=1奇异,在与相应的线性算子第一特征值有关的条件下,利用不动点指数方法,获得了次线性脉冲Sturm-Liouville边值问题正解的存在性结果。第四章本文在不要求f连续的前提下,利用较为宽松的条件研究了Banach空间中非线性混合型微分-积分方程初值问题解的存在唯一性以及解的迭代逼近,改进和推广了最近的一些结果,并有新的应用。
【Abstract】 Nonlinear functional analysis is an important branch of mordern analysis mathematics. It can explain a lot of natural phenomena clearly,so more and more mathematicans and mathematical researchers are devoting their time to it. Among them, the nonlinear initial value problem and boundary value problem comes from a lot of branches of applied mathematics and physics, it is at present one of the most active fields that is studied in analyse mathematics. The present paper employs the cone theory, fixed point theory, fixed point index methord and upper and lower methord and so on, to investigate the existence of solutions to initial value problem and boundary value problem of several kinds of nonlinear systems of differential equations. The obtained results are either new or intrinsically generalize and improve the previous relevant ones under weaker conditions.The thesis is divided into four sections according to contents.In chapter 1, it is the introduction of this paper, which introduces the main contents of this paper.In chapter 2, Allowing h(t) is singular at t=0 and t=1,the existence of multiple positive solutions of second-order three-point boundary value problems is attained.The existence results are given by using Krasnoselskii fixed point theorem and Leggett-Williams fixed point theorem.In Chapter 3, Allowing h(t) is singular at t=0 and t=1,the existence of positive solutions of sublinear impulsive Sturm-Liouville boundary value problems is attained.The existence results are given by means of the fixed point index under some conditions concerning the first eigenvalues corresponding to the relevant linear operator .In Chapter 4, In this paper,the initial value problem of the nonlinear integro-differential equations in Banach spaces is investigated under the condi- tion weaker than the continuity of f.The existence and uniqueness and iterative approximation of solution for the initial value problem is abtained.The results presented here not only improve and extend many results,but also apply to other aspects.
